Is The Nigerian Navy Batch 36 NNBTS Examination Date for 2024 Out?

The Nigerian Navy Batch 36 NNBTS examination date for shortlisted candidates and candidates whose names came out on the supplementary list are to report to their respective center for an examination which will take place on Saturday, 17 February 2024, Time 7: 00 am prompt.

Any of the shortlisted candidates who fail to report to various examination centers on Saturday, 17 February 2024 will be disqualified from the process.

In addition, when reporting to any of the Nigerian Navy Basic Training Schools in Lagos State, Onne, Port Harcourt, Rivers State or Kaduna, shortlisted candidates are to report with their application form printout, credentials, a coloured passport-sized photograph and your writing materials.

Nigerian Navy [Batch 36 NNBTS Training] Requirement For Supplementary Shortlisted Candidates

The Nigerian Navy training on all Batch 36 shortlisted candidates is another huge task ahead of all candidates to prepare them for physical conditioning, academic testing, swimming, marching, drilling etc.

The most essential part of Nigerian Navy recruitment is the training aspect, which will begin after the examination has been conducted. Successful candidates, who pass the Nigerian Navy Batch 36 examination, are to report to their training centers with the following requirements below.

Your original credentials and a photocopy of each of your credentials  Two (2) Bed sheets (Navy blue) and a Blanket Two (2) pairs of black trousers
Two white long-sleeve shirts  Two pairs of Native wear Toiletries
 Two white Bedsheets  Mosquito Net Bank Verification Number (BVN) printout
Two black ties  Three pairs of white long socks  Two (2) pairs of brown canvas
 Two Navy blue Physical Training shorts Two sets of cutleries  Two white round-neck vests
Two pairs of white canvas National Identification Number (NIN) print-out slip  One or two pairs of black shoes
